Throat issue
Having cough and cold but got a red swollen skin behind my right tonsil its giving a pinching pain sometimes. This has never happened so please put some light on the topic i had asked this question earlier too but got no response. I have also undergone a vocal chord surgery in feb so do i need to worry about it.

during attacks of cough and cold its normal to have some granular red swellings over posterior pharyx. its usually harmless and resolves with treatment. take antibiotics, analgesic with anti cold medicines for few days. also do salt water gargling. if symptoms persist then you need to get your throat examined by specialist near you
